Chiranjeevi's adhinayakdu on the way








Chiranjeevi has indeed taken a long break, after the release of Shankar Dada Zindabad, for his next film. Several reasons, including personal problems, Ram Charan Teja's launch as hero and rumours about his political ambitions have contributed to the long delay.

With 148 films under his belt, Adhinayakudu (the working title of the movie) would be his 149th film. So the responsibility of scripting a good story for the film was handed over to Paruchuri Brothers. Keeping in mind Chiranjeevi's political aspirations, the duo prepared four different scripts and one of them was okayed? by Chiranjeevi. Paruchuri brothers reportedly left for Bangkok accompanied by director N Shankar to give the final touches to the script.

Though V. V. Vinayak, Krishnavamsi and Gunasekhar were all considered to direct Chirajeevi's 149th movie, the opportunity landed in N Shankar's eager hands. He has directed films like Encounter, Sriramulaiah and Jayam Manadera. The shooting of the film is likely to begin during May and is set to be completed by December before the forthcoming general elections. Ashwini Dutt, Allu Aravind, K Raghavendra Rao are jointly producing the movie.
